we're gonna do two things out here we are going to evaluate the plants we're going to see how healthy things are and then we're also going to be grabbing some tissue samples we're gonna be grabbing the leaves I like to start down below I want to look at the leaves do we have leaves drooping down do we have brown starting to creep up the stalks what do our brace Reds look like those things that stick out above the ground do we have them braced way off the top like this one here it's kind of high that one's a little higher that one that's what I like to see right at the surface of the ground how thick are the stocks that's a big old girthy thing geez looks like we had maybe some deficiency of some sort when the plant was a little bit smaller it's starting to become evident now then as we work our way up we're just going to start looking at leaves are we seeing any lesions on the leaves that would indicate we have some disease the biggest one we seem to have an issue with around here lately is tar spot so we're just looking for a literally just a black dot on the leaf hopefully we don't find it this field was planted with our white planter and compared to last year looking at the ear Heights much much more consistent and our spacing from plant to plant take a look at that a whole lot better we don't really have any doubles right here we got a skip so either one was there it did not come up or one did not get planted but that is a significant Improvement wow and then we got a little runt right here so that one won't amount to anything we want to minimize those as much as we can just look how much smaller that little ear is on it and it's there's nothing even in there last year we had a runt like that it seemed like like every six plants so one two three four five six hey no runs one two three mmm baby run four five six one two three four five six that's better there's another one that one's a little bit smaller but not as bad as it could be we're definitely not perfect yet I don't know if we'll ever be perfect but we're making strides in the right direction this corn is fully pollinated we got brown silks Brown silks means it's pollinated if we got some little blonde ones coming out so I take it those didn't get pollinated or is it possible that the ear got bigger after it pollinated and then those shot out saying like hey we can actually pollinate more but at that point no pollen was falling from the tassels anymore so those won't ever get pollinated we don't have any more pollen falling like this guy here look at that we got a nice pollination out of him that's a nice size here too I have noticed this more than I would like to see those are Japanese beetles just absolutely diving into where the silks used to be it got clipped off and now they're trying to eat those fresh ones down inside of there those stinking things I'm kind of tempted to maybe change the insecticide we're using because especially in the soy beans I just I have more eating action going on than I would like to see so this is what I did not want to see we got some tar spot starting right here we know that it's tar spot see how it's just like a nice little speckle right there I'm going to try rubbing it off it doesn't come off so we got this back there we got this pack there looks like I got a little bit bigger lesion here we got some down there good news is that's on the bottom part of the plant so that's below the ear these ears or these leaves are going to be the ones that start dropping off first but we really want to protect these upper ears when we find it through the upper ears that are upper leaves that's when it's more of a problem so hopefully it just stays down here right now we did get a fungicide on this but I've been told once you see tar spot it's already been in the plant for like two weeks so at that point fungicide is kind of too late it's more of a preventative measure which this one is not a high Management Field so we just did a laid fungicide on it once we hit Brown silk oh next up we are on the North Farm white did a nice job with the air placement here though look at that all on the same note that's what we like to mystery with the non-planted field it looks like it is going to be a co-op south side of Mary Lou's as for the beans there's not really a whole lot to look at basically we're looking to see how many bugs are doing munching on here we're right on the edge on the grass there's going to be a lot it is better out there we're seeing how much they're shaded in they should be fully shaded in at this point and then we are just pulling up plants while we're looking at spacing see how far they are spaced apart just like corn and we'll pull plant oh man half of it just fell off but look at that I'm also looking at the top part of the plant we'll find one that's intact here but be very tippity top is no longer putting a flower on anymore so that means it is not going to set any more new ones of these try leaves so it's not going to be getting any taller it is just solely focused on making pods now I walked out actual testing era you can see my flag right there I pull the plant these ones look a whole lot better we don't have nearly as much feeding going on even though we do have all those guys just chilling on that leaf right there but pull this plant up here looks a little bit different than the one I had on the end row it's still starting to set more pods it's not quite developed as the one over there but we're seeing some really nice development going on I also pull them if I can get them out like this look at the roots if I have a shovel you can do it every time but yanking out usually all those little balls that look like little spider eggs those are what's called punctualization I believe that's what is actually fixates nitrogen from the soil for the plant soybeans are a legume so they can fixate throw nitrogen and then I'm looking at a big root that's sticking out on the bottom that one right there that is the Tap Root we want to make sure that's growing straight down if it is it means we have a nice healthy plant now north side of Mary loose these are the beans and carols they're branching nice they're starting to look good I think these are also at their last flower right at the top don't see a flower coming right there we scouted until it's
